Pirelli comes out on top in the Dow Jones Sustainability Index for auto parts and tires

Sept. 21, 2008

Pirelli & Cie SpA has been confirmed world leader in the "Auto Parts and Tires" segment of the Dow Jones Sustainability Indexes for the second year in a row.

The company was the highest ranking in its segment on the basis of the latest global analysis of corporate sustainability leadership by specialist SAM (Sustainable Asset Management) Group Holding AG, which evaluated companies' sustainability performance from an economic, social and environmental point of view.

Pirelli has been included in the Dow Jones Sustainability Indexes since 2002 and is currently listed both in the European Dow Jones STOXX Sustainability Index and in the global Dow Jones Sustainability World Index.

The Pirelli Group also was confirmed in the Financial Times Global and European FTSE4Good sustainability indexes following the latest six-monthly review by EIRIS Foundation analysts. Pirelli has been listed in these indexes since 2002.
